A Burning Bush Encounter

Look and see! I am moving so that you may encounter Me. I am the God of the burning bush and my presence is holy. Remove your shoes for you are standing on holy ground. Cast off all that hinders and hear the words I have for you.

My child, why are you so distracted and your attention so short? Why is it that you seem surprised I want to talk to you at this moment? Do I not know what you are facing and the burdens you are carrying?

And yet I am calling you. I am calling you for important Kingdom assignments. I need one who hears My words and repeats them faithfully; who can take my messages to where I need them to be said; who can deliver them no matter what the situation they find themselves in.

For I am the Sovereign Lord and I want you as my emissary, to go where I send you, to set my people free from the tyrannies that bind them, from the paralysis of fear and the enemy’s condemnations, from the straitjacket of worldly systems and the mistruths of global society. Go and set My people free.

Application:
Read through the passage in scripture of Moses encountering the burning bush (Exodus 3:1-12) and then consider the following: 

This is a burning bush moment. Consider the ground you are standing on – it is holy. You are in the presence of the Living God. Pay careful attention to what the Lord is saying to you.

What is it that He is calling you to? It may be a new mission – ask Him for clarity and guidance; it might be something familiar but He is granting you more authority and responsibility – ask Him for perception and humility; or it could be a tough assignment which leads to hurt and rejection – ask Him for courage and discernment.

Remember this: He is the Lord. He is the Holy One. He has chosen you. Will you go as His ambassador?

John 15:16 (NIV)
You did not choose me, but I chose you and appointed you so that you might go and bear fruit—fruit that will last—and so that whatever you ask in my name the Father will give you.

Deuteronomy 33:13-16 (NIV)
May the Lord bless His land with the precious dew from heaven above and with the deep waters that lie below; with the best the sun brings forth and the finest the moon can yield; with the choicest gifts of the ancient mountains and the fruitfulness of the everlasting hills; with the best gifts of the earth and its fullness and the favour of Him who dwelt in the burning bush.
